How Understanding Local Arrest Charges Works in Real Life
Each charge has elements that must be proven, including the specific act and the intent behind it, which legal professionals refer to as mens rea. For example, a theft charge usually requires proof that someone took property without permission and intended to keep it permanently. Knowing these elements helps you understand what the prosecutor must show in court. When you familiarize yourself with terms like βburglaryβ or βpossession,β you can read basic case summaries or news items with more clarity. This knowledge does not replace legal advice, but it builds a foundation for more confident discussions with attorneys or local resources.
Common Arrest Charges in Haralson County
Property-Related Offenses
Property-related charges, such as burglary and theft, are frequently mentioned in county-level reports. Burglary often involves entering a structure with the intent to commit a crime inside, while theft focuses on taking someone elseβs property without consent. Local examples might include taking tools from an unlocked garage or removing items from a storage unit without permission. The value of the property usually affects whether a charge is filed as a misdemeanor or a felony. Understanding these distinctions helps you recognize how small decisions, like securing sheds or reporting suspicious activity, can reduce risks in your neighborhood.
Traffic and Vehicle Charges
Traffic stops are a common way people first interact with law enforcement, and they can lead to charges when rules are violated. Typical vehicle-related charges include driving under the influence, reckless driving, and driving without a valid license. For instance, a driver stopped for swerving might be asked to perform field sobriety tests, and results can influence whether further charges are pursued. Even small details, such as an expired registration, can escalate a routine stop if an officer notices other issues. By knowing what behaviors increase risk, you can make safer choices behind the wheel and reduce the likelihood of serious consequences.
Public Order and Minor Offenses
Public order charges often appear in local data and usually involve behavior that disrupts community peace, such as disorderly conduct or simple trespassing. These offenses may arise from loud arguments, fights in public spaces, or remaining on property after being asked to leave. While they are typically less serious than violent crimes, they can still result in fines, court appearances, or a record that affects employment. Many of these situations stem from misunderstandings or heightened emotions, and they can often be resolved through mediation or community programs. Understanding what behavior crosses the line helps you de-escalate conflicts and protect your legal standing.
Common Questions People Have About Local Arrest Charges
What Should I Do If I Am Arrested in Haralson County?
If you are arrested, staying calm and clearly stating that you wish to speak with an attorney can protect your rights during questioning. Avoid arguing with officers, and remember that anything you say may be used in court. You have the right to remain silent and to contact legal representation, even if you cannot afford a lawyer immediately. Following these steps reduces the chance of unintentionally harming your defense. Local legal aid organizations and bar associations can often point you to affordable resources if you need guidance quickly.
How Can I Find Information About Charges in My Area?
Public records in Georgia often allow residents to look up arrests and case outcomes through court websites or sheriffβs office portals. These sources typically provide basic details such as the charge, date, and case status without including sensitive personal information. Searching these records can help you understand trends in your community and recognize which types of charges are most common. At the same time, official reports can be complex, so pairing them with explanations from trusted community groups makes the information easier to use. Using this data responsibly supports more informed conversations about safety and policy.
Can a First Offense Have Long-Term Consequences?
Even a single arrest or conviction can affect housing, employment, and professional licensing, depending on the charge and the outcome. Some offenses may be eligible for diversion programs or expungement, which can reduce long-term impacts if you complete certain requirements. Misdemeanors are generally less likely to appear in background checks than felonies, but the specifics depend on the court and the nature of the offense. Talking with a local attorney early can clarify your options and help you take the right steps to protect your future. Each situation is different, so personalized advice is important.

What Are Common Misconceptions About Local Crime?
Television dramas and viral posts often create exaggerated ideas about how frequently certain crimes occur, leading people to overestimate their personal risk. In reality, many rural counties have lower violent crime rates than urban areas, even if property crimes receive local attention. It is also a misconception that all arrests lead to convictions; many cases are dismissed, result in plea deals, or never move forward in court. By focusing on verified statistics and trusted community sources, you can replace fear with a balanced view of safety. Correcting these myths supports smarter decisions for your household and neighborhood.

What Should I Remember About Privacy and Due Process?
Arrest information is often public, but it does not tell the full story about a personβs guilt or innocence. Accused individuals are presumed innocent until proven guilty, and many charges do not result in a conviction. Respecting privacy and avoiding public speculation protects both the accused and the community from unnecessary harm. When you review public records or news reports, focus on facts rather than assumptions. This approach keeps conversations grounded and supports a fair legal process for everyone involved.
